The 3-star Belvedere hotel is a great place in a rural area of Brodick, which stands a 25-minute walk from Arran Cheese Shop. Wi-Fi is offered throughout the property and public parking is available on site.
Location
Located just 5 minutes' stroll from James of Arran, this comfortable bed & breakfast is within sight of Arran Coastal way Walkway. Belfast is 90 minutes' drive from the hotel, while Glen Rosa is 3.1 km away. The local beach is a 5-minute walk away. Belvedere hotel is also 2.9 km from the landscaped gardens "Brodick Castle".
Brodick Library bus stop is at a distance of only a few minutes from this property.
